I am getting a shipboard credit for booking with DU. Will it be on our account when we check in at the port or what?
 
If you booked during a stateroom credit promotion you should get a notice in your stateroom. If not, just go to Guest Services, they will have it on your master account that you get the credit. :)
 
We booked through DU and they gave us a $50.00 Rebate. That money was taken off our cruise total before making final payment. So, check and make sure if it is an on board credit or rebate. Just in case you are expecting the credit when boarding, it may have been already applied to your account. :smooth:
 

Dreams Unlimited was able to add the First Time Cruiser credit ($25) to my 4 day cruise. I asked here on the boards before I left if I should take any proof along and was told not to worry about it, that the credit would be there. Well, paranoid as I am, I took along the e-mail from Dreams Unlimited confirming the credit was added to my reservation. Good thing, too. The credit was NOT on my onboard account and the Guest Services said that they could not help me unless I had some form of proof from my travel agent. Once I retrieved the e-mail from my stateroom, Guest Services again tried to turn me down saying the credit was not applicable to cruises in 2003. I insisted that DU had been successful in applying the credit and they finally made the call and had the credit added.
